DMK President and former Chief Minister M Karunanidhi who was readmitted to the Kauvery hospital has undergone tracheostomy to optimise breathing a short while ago.<br/><br/>A press release by Dr S Aravindan, Executive Director of the hospital said that the procedure was done to ease the breathing difficulty in throat and lung infection. His condition is said to be stable and he was being treated on antibiotics by a team of doctors.<br/><br/>
